Question

evaluate. write your answer in simplified, rationalized form. do not round.

$$ cot left( \frac { pi } { 6 } ight) = $$

Explanation:

Step1: Use the cotangent formula

We know that \(\cot\theta=\frac{\cos\theta}{\sin\theta}\). For \(\theta = \frac{\pi}{6}\), \(\cos(\frac{\pi}{6})=\frac{\sqrt{3}}{2}\) and \(\sin(\frac{\pi}{6})=\frac{1}{2}\).
So, \(\cot(\frac{\pi}{6})=\frac{\cos(\frac{\pi}{6})}{\sin(\frac{\pi}{6})}\).

Step2: Substitute the values

Substitute \(\cos(\frac{\pi}{6})=\frac{\sqrt{3}}{2}\) and \(\sin(\frac{\pi}{6})=\frac{1}{2}\) into the formula:
\(\cot(\frac{\pi}{6})=\frac{\frac{\sqrt{3}}{2}}{\frac{1}{2}}\).
When dividing by a fraction, we multiply by its reciprocal. So \(\frac{\frac{\sqrt{3}}{2}}{\frac{1}{2}}=\frac{\sqrt{3}}{2}\times\frac{2}{1}\).
The \(2\)s cancel out.

Answer:

\(\sqrt{3}\)
